Day 1: Guangzhou

Guangzhou, located in the northern part of Guangdong, is the capital and largest city of the province, known for its history, culture, and modern architecture.

Suggested activities

  • Visit to the Canton Tower: The Canton Tower is a famous landmark located in Guangzhou, known for its observation deck offering panoramic views of the city.
  • Visit to the Temple of the Six Banyan Trees: The Temple of the Six Banyan Trees is a Buddhist temple located in Guangzhou, known for its beautiful architecture and serene atmosphere. Visitors can explore the temple and learn about the history and culture of the area.
  • Visit to the Chen Clan Ancestral Hall: The Chen Clan Ancestral Hall is a traditional Chinese hall located in Guangzhou, known for its well-preserved architecture and rich history. Visitors can explore the hall and learn about the local culture.

Day 4-5: Shenzhen

Shenzhen, located in the southern part of Guangdong, is a city known for its modern technology, innovative culture, and beautiful natural scenery.

Suggested activities

  • Visit to the Window of the World: The Window of the World is a theme park located in Shenzhen, known for its miniature replicas of famous landmarks from around the world.
  • Visit to the Shenzhen Museum: The Shenzhen Museum is a modern museum showcasing the history and culture of Shenzhen and the surrounding area. Visitors can see many ancient artifacts and learn about the local way of life.
  • Visit to the Dafen Oil Painting Village: The Dafen Oil Painting Village is a village located in Shenzhen, known for its oil painting industry. Visitors can take a tour of the village and see the many art galleries and shops.
  • Visit to the Splendid China Folk Village: The Splendid China Folk Village is a theme park located in Shenzhen, known for its miniature replicas of famous Chinese landmarks.
